Brokerage outage: Schwab blames high trading volumes and a technical issue

Charles Schwab & Co. said on Tuesday that high trading volumes and a technical issue with a key vendor triggered temporary outages on its trading platform on Monday, a day when its customers rushed to navigate an outsize market sell-off.

Airbnb forecasts lower third-quarter revenue as U.S. demand slows

Airbnb forecast third-quarter revenue below estimates on Tuesday and warned of shorter booking windows, suggesting travelers were waiting until the last minute to book due to economic uncertainty, sending its shares down about 14.63% after the bell.

These 5 states are pushing Elon Musk to fix X’s chatbot. Here’s why

Secretaries of state from five U.S. states urged billionaire Elon Musk on Monday to fix social media platform X’s AI chatbot, saying it had spread misinformation related to the Nov. 5 election.

Uber stock price gets a lift as earnings report shows people ordered more rideshares

Uber’s stock price (ticker: UBER) is currently up over 6% in premarket trading as of the time of this writing, after the rideshare company beat expected earnings and revenue estimates for its Q2 2024.
